Solds In Rolling Meadows from 1/2010 to 11/30/2010 revealed:Average Sales Price: $141,767 Average Sold Price Per Sq. Ft.: $103/sf Median Sold Price: $139,900Number of Sales: 3 Average Number of Days On Market: 110 Days Low To High: $135,500 to $149,900 THE CHART BELOW SHOWS A “COOLING” OF THE VERY HIGH POST HURRICANE KATRINA SALES PRICE, A DROP FROM $108.32/SF TO $103.04/SF, WHICH IS HEALTHY FOR THIS “First Time Homebuyer Market where $157,500 was just too much to pay for housing!
